Chelsea fan Glen Randles had plenty to cheer about at the weekend with Chelsea winning there FA Cup tie comfortably and Glen and his team of Steve O'Loughlin, Roy Joynson & Keith Francis winning the Best 2 from 4 competition with 73 points over 15 holes on a card playoff from Murray Watters, Tom Jones, John Boyd & Gary Crowder. In 3rd place were Graeme Money Peter Benson Steve Davies & Geoff Smith with 71 points. There were 5 twos worth £21.60 per team.

The Ladies competition on Tuesday in Gale Force conditions was won by Caroline Berry with 25 points over 15 holes with Jackie Johnston 2nd with 22 points.
Out on the course we managed to get Electric Trolleys back on for one afternoon until the rain on Tuesday night and Wednesday morning flooded the course. The Greenstaff this week (while it was dry!!) managed to start work at the front of the 10th and hopefully we will be able to start turfing it in the near future when we get another dry spell.
